You (anthony.xu) said:
> I noticed that you use do_yield instead of do_block in xen-event.patch.
> 
> I think do_yield will incur some unnecessary schedule before it can resume
> to Guest.

  Is this comment about vmx_send_assist_req() ?

  So, it sets _VCPUF_blocked_in_xen flags before the code to use
do_yield. Thus, the VTi domain will be blocked until clear flags
via new xen-evtchn notification, I think.

** cf. evtchn_send() in xen/common/event_channel.c
